북괴
Korean
Etymology
Sino-Korean word from 北傀, from 北 (“north”) + 傀 (“puppet”)
Pronunciation
- (SK Standard/Seoul) IPA(key): [puk̚k͈we̞] ~ [puk̚k͈ø̞]
- Phonetic hangul: [북꿰/북꾀]
